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Mandalay Bay Beach is situated at the southernmost point of the Las Vegas Strip, providing a distinct atmosphere compared to the high-density center of the resort corridor. Access is primarily handled via Las Vegas Boulevard or the I-15 freeway using the Russell Road or Sunset Road exits. The venue is approximately 3 miles from Harry Reid International Airport, typically resulting in a 10 to 15-minute drive depending on traffic conditions. Parking is extensive, featuring a large multi-level garage connected to the main resort complex, though weekend events often necessitate arriving well before showtime to ensure a smooth transition from your vehicle.

Navigating the area is best achieved by utilizing rideshare services, which have dedicated drop-off points near the resort entrance. During major concert nights, Las Vegas Boulevard can experience significant congestion, so planning your arrival around two hours before the event starts is a smart tactic. Walking between neighboring properties is possible via pedestrian bridges, though the sheer scale of the resort means you should account for extra time to reach the specific beach entrance. Always check the resort signage upon arrival, as the beach area is tucked behind the main pool complex and requires specific credentialing or ticket verification for entry.

Section 02

Where to Stay

Visitors typically choose to stay directly within the Mandalay Bay, Delano, or Luxor properties to maintain immediate proximity to the venue. These hotels are connected via interior walkways and a free tram system, making them the most convenient options for concert-goers who want to avoid external traffic. If you prefer a different atmosphere, nearby resorts like the MGM Grand offer a short rideshare trip away while keeping you within the heart of the southern Strip action.

During peak event weekends or major festivals, demand spikes significantly, often leading to limited availability and higher room rates. It is highly recommended to book your accommodations at least three to four months in advance to secure a room within the complex. If you are traveling as part of a large group, booking early ensures you can coordinate stay locations and simplify your logistics for meeting up before and after the show.

Section 04

Show Night Flow

Arrival & Pre-Event

Plan to arrive at the resort at least two hours before the show begins to navigate the large property. Once you have parked, follow the clear signage directing guests through the casino floor toward the beach entrance. Security screening is thorough, so have your digital or physical tickets ready to expedite the process. Grab a drink or a quick snack in the resort before heading to the beach area to avoid potential lines. This extra time allows you to find your spot and acclimate to the outdoor venue environment.

During the Event

The venue features a unique sand-covered floor and a stage set against the pool backdrop, creating an intimate concert experience. Concessions are located around the perimeter of the beach area, offering various drinks and light refreshments throughout the show. Keep track of your group by establishing a clear meeting point, as the space can get crowded once the music starts. Restrooms are accessible from the beach deck, though expect short waits during the peak intermission period. Stay hydrated throughout the night, especially during the warmer months when the desert heat persists.

Post-Event & Departure

Exiting the beach area can be slow due to the large crowd density, so remain patient as you head back toward the casino. If you are using rideshare, head directly to the designated zone, but be prepared for high demand and surge pricing immediately after the final song. Walking back to your hotel room within the complex is the fastest departure method for those staying on-site. Avoid trying to leave the parking garage at the exact same time as the rest of the crowd to save time. Following the event, the resort remains lively, offering plenty of late-night dining options.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ter months are cool, with daytime highs in the 50s and 60s. You will want to pack a light jacket or sweater for the evenings when temperatures drop significantly. While outdoor concerts are less frequent, the mild weather is perfect for walking between resorts comfortably.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ring provides the most pleasant weather, with temperatures ranging from the 70s to low 80s. It is the ideal time for outdoor beach events, allowing you to enjoy the venue comfortably. Layers are recommended as mornings can be brisk before the desert sun warms the day.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er is extremely hot, with temperatures regularly exceeding 100 degrees. Stay hydrated and seek shade whenever possible, especially during outdoor events at the beach. Light, breathable clothing is essential, and you should plan to spend the hottest parts of the day in air-conditioned environments.

🍂

Fall season

Fall brings a return to comfortable temperatures, much like the spring. It is a popular time for festivals and outdoor shows, making it a busy and exciting period for the city. Pack a mix of light daytime clothes and a jacket for the cooler evening air.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is rare in the desert but can occur as short, intense bursts. Snow is virtually non-existent in the city, though it may appear on the nearby mountains. Always check the forecast before your trip, but generally, weather-related event cancellations are very uncommon in Las Vegas.
